The fresh herbs and fruits give great summer flavors and the moscato makes it sweet. If you want it less on the sweet side you could use a dry white or just use less of the simple syrup.
I decided to make the agave simple syrup because lately whenever I attempt to make one out of sugar and water I fail miserably. (I’m still on the hunt for the trick to that). But this is such a simple way to make a flavored simple syrup and avoid a grainy texture!
This is a great make ahead punch, I made the simple syrup and let it sit in the fridge with the Moscato (the one I bought was not carbonated) and then add the soda water when you’re ready to serve!
The Innards:
Peach, Strawberry and Herb Simple Syrup -
- 1 Peach, sliced
- 1 cup Strawberries, halved
- 1/4 cup Agave Syrup
- 1/4 cup water
- 3 Rosemary Sprigs
- 2 Mint Sprigs
The Sangria -
- 3 Bottles Moscato Wine
- 3 Liters Soda Water (lemon flavored optional, but unsweetened)
- 1-2 Fresh Peaches, sliced
- 1 cup Fresh Strawberries, sliced
- More fresh Mint than Rosemary twigs
Serves: A lot! It’s so very easy to cut this recipe down if you aren’t making it for a large group. I liked the ratio of one soda water per bottle of wine but you can adjust that as your taste prefers.
How to Make the Syrup:
1. Cut your peaches and strawberries up.
2. Place your fruit, herbs, agave and water in a pot on medium heat.
3. Bring to a boil and let simmer for about 5 minutes.
4. Take off the heat and cool completely before straining out the fruit and herbs
5. It’s best to combine your wine and simple syrup in a large pitcher and place in the fridge for a few hours or overnight.
Then add in your soda water when you are ready to serve and enjoy!
